    Hello

    We recommend 3 ml per gallon. Start with 1/3 dose or 1 ml per gallon. A 75 gallon tank would need 225 ml of pearls. Flow rate I cannot giver you because that really depends on the reactor you have. You want the flow to be slow but steady - please see the video in the other post to get an idea of flow rate as judge by the tumbling action of the pearls.

    How are these different: first, our pearls are pure - you are getting 100% biodegradeable polymer many other products are not nearly as pure. Basically, you get more bang for your buck.

    Secondly, the pearls are made from bacteria so they are 100% natural and will not leave any residue in your tank.
